Bill Summary · S 4665

Summary of Bill S 4665

Bill Overview

  • Bill Number: S 4665
  • Title: Establishes a local government salt brine equipment grant program; appropriation
  • Status: Referred to Finance
  • Introduced On: February 11, 2025
  • Classification: Bill

Purpose and Intent

The primary purpose of Bill S 4665 is to establish a grant program aimed at local governments for the acquisition of salt brine equipment. This initiative is designed to enhance the efficiency and effectiveness of snow and ice management operations, particularly in response to winter weather conditions. By providing financial support for the necessary equipment, the bill seeks to promote safer road conditions and reduce the environmental impact associated with traditional de-icing methods.

Key Provisions

  • Grant Program Establishment: The bill proposes the creation of a dedicated grant program that will allocate funds to local governments for the purchase of salt brine equipment.
  • Funding Appropriation: Specific appropriations will be made to support the grant program, although the exact dollar amounts are not detailed in the current version of the bill.
  • Eligibility Criteria: Local governments will be eligible to apply for grants, although further details on the application process and criteria are expected to be outlined in subsequent legislative discussions or regulations.

Impact

  • Local Governments: The bill directly affects local government entities that manage winter road maintenance. By facilitating access to salt brine equipment, these entities can improve their operational capabilities.
  • Public Safety: Enhanced snow and ice management through the use of salt brine is anticipated to lead to safer driving conditions during winter months, potentially reducing accidents and improving public safety.
  • Environmental Considerations: Salt brine is often considered a more environmentally friendly alternative to traditional rock salt, which can have detrimental effects on vegetation and water quality. The bill may contribute to more sustainable practices in winter road maintenance.

Procedural Aspects

  • Current Status: As of February 11, 2025, the bill has been referred to the Finance Committee for further consideration. The timeline for subsequent actions, including potential hearings or votes, will depend on the committee's schedule and priorities.
